The renewal of our three-year agreement with Torvane Materials has been assessed in detail. Proposed terms include a 4.2% unit-price increase, partially offset by improved volume rebates and extended payment terms of sixty days. Sensitivity analysis indicates a net annual cost impact of under 1% on the Meridia product line, assuming stable demand. Legal has flagged no material changes to liability clauses. We recommend approval, subject to the conditions outlined in the confidential note below.

confidential, yawip-bahif: Zorokox Partners plans to lower the Casax list price by 28.0 percent in April. The board signed off on a budget of $271.0 million for Project Juldor. The renewal with Pelokox Partners closes at $410.1 million a year, 3.4 percent below the last contract. Project Pelok slips by a full year because of the audit delay.

Subject: Soft-delete cut-over — done!

Hi Marguerite,

Quick recap: the Ordana orders table is now on soft deletes as of last night's cut-over. Hard deletes are disabled at the API layer, the backfill of the deleted_at column finished clean, and the nightly purge job is paused until we're confident. Two hiccups with stale read replicas, both resolved before morning. Reporting queries were updated to filter tombstoned rows. For the record, the service is now running with the following configuration values.

deployment values, yadug-bawif:
[framir]
team = pelox
access_code = ac_a38ab2
owner = tamion.julael
host = framir.tolvaqlabs.test
port = 11211
peer = tammir.zemvargrid.local
salt = 2215ef03
pin = 1541

## Escalation

If Nightloom backfill jobs stall past 03:00 UTC, check the scheduler lock table first. Stale locks older than 90 minutes: clear and requeue. Do not restart the coordinator mid-run; partial backfills corrupt watermark state. Two consecutive failed runs means the data platform rotation owns it. Page them, then document the incident in the Nightloom log. For unresolved cases, reach the platform escalation desk here.

escalation mailbox, bafog-fafog: ulador@paliqlabs.internal